  7. Hi thanks for the help. Just purchesed a 98 pulse ambulance. I have tried the above with no luck with the d5 in my pulse ambulance, my heater starts up and will run continuously when the dial is turned to the blue spot, however when turned to the red section of the dial the heater blows for 20 seconds and then trips out, ie causes the switch to jump to the out / off position. The heater was tried to be started more times than 4 so has probably been locked out and this may have been due to low fuel as only had 1/8 th of a tank but upon refilling and trying the above mentioned trick no luck!
